Home
Brands
SEAT
LEON (1P1) 2.0 TDI (170 hp) [2006-2012]
Used Car Parts Catalog
Interior
Front right window mechanism
Your car
SEAT LEON (1P1) 2.0 TDI (170 hp)
Parts
Airbags
1,012
Body Parts
8,212
Electrical and Electronic
337
Interior
8,756
Lights
930
Engine & Transmission
359
Not identified
142
Suspension
106
Sets
30kg+
Read more about
CO₂
savings
Reference
-
645 Results
Recommended
Price () Ascending
Price () Descending
New
Fast delivery
2
Left hand drive
BP8560099C23
Front right window mechanism
SEAT
LEON (1P1) [2005-2013]
[2005-2013]
1P0837402D | 1P0837402D |
-
-
£ 62.80
Shipping and VAT
are
included
in the price.
3 to 5 working days
2
Left hand drive
BP9446251C23
Front right window mechanism
SEAT
LEON (1P1) [2005-2013]
[2005-2013]
1P0837402E |
-
-
£ 62.80
Shipping and VAT
are
included
in the price.
3 to 5 working days
12
Left hand drive
BP12116406C23
Front right window mechanism
SEAT
LEON (1P1)
1.9 TDI (105 hp)
[2005-2010]
1P0837462A | 1P0837462A
5
BKC
-
£ 62.80
Shipping and VAT
are
included
in the price.
3 to 5 working days
11
Left hand drive
BP12125464C23
Front right window mechanism
SEAT
LEON (1P1) [2005-2013]
[2005-2013]
1P0837462A | 1P0837462A
5
-
-
£ 62.80
Shipping and VAT
are
included
in the price.
3 to 5 working days
5
Left hand drive
BP12634166C23
Front right window mechanism
SEAT
LEON (1P1)
2.0 TDI (140 hp)
[2005-2010]
CAJA | 3
5
BMM
-
£ 62.80
Shipping and VAT
are
included
in the price.
4 to 6 working days
16
Left hand drive
BP18010578C23
Front right window mechanism
SEAT
LEON (1P1)
2.0 TDI (170 hp)
[2006-2012]
1P0837462A | 1P0837462A
5
BMN
-
£ 62.80
Shipping and VAT
are
included
in the price.
3 to 5 working days
21
Left hand drive
BP26375606C23
Front right window mechanism
SEAT
LEON (1P1)
1.9 TDI (105 hp)
[2005-2010]
1K0959792H | 1T0959702C
5
-
-
£ 62.80
Shipping and VAT
are
included
in the price.
3 to 5 working days
3
Left hand drive
BP28703180C23
Front right window mechanism
SEAT
LEON (1P1) [2005-2013]
[2005-2013]
1K0959792H |
3
-
-
£ 62.80
Shipping and VAT
are
included
in the price.
3 to 5 working days
18
Left hand drive
BP30717284C23
Front right window mechanism
SEAT
LEON (1P1)
2.0 TDI 16V (140 hp)
[2005-2012]
1P0837462A | 1P0837462A
5
-
138474
£ 62.80
Shipping and VAT
are
included
in the price.
3 to 5 working days
16
Left hand drive
BP15585102C23
Front right window mechanism
SEAT
LEON (1P1) [2005-2013]
[2005-2013]
1P0867436
5
-
216432
£ 63.85
Shipping and VAT
are
included
in the price.
4 to 6 working days
16
Left hand drive
BP21128983C23
Front right window mechanism
SEAT
LEON (1P1) [2005-2013]
[2005-2013]
1P0837462A | 1P0837402M
5
-
94910
£ 63.85
Shipping and VAT
are
included
in the price.
4 to 6 working days
9
Left hand drive
BP23197514C23
Front right window mechanism
SEAT
LEON (1P1)
1.9 TDI (105 hp)
[2005-2010]
1K0959792M
5
-
127753
£ 63.85
Shipping and VAT
are
included
in the price.
3 to 5 working days
15
Left hand drive
BP23254080C23
Front right window mechanism
SEAT
LEON (1P1)
2.0 TDI (170 hp)
[2006-2012]
1P0837462A
5
-
159142
£ 63.85
Shipping and VAT
are
included
in the price.
4 to 6 working days
15
Left hand drive
BP23501689C23
Front right window mechanism
SEAT
LEON (1P1)
2.0 TDI (170 hp)
[2006-2012]
1P0837462A
5
-
159142
£ 63.85
Shipping and VAT
are
included
in the price.
4 to 6 working days
12
Left hand drive
BP30175082C23
Front right window mechanism
SEAT
LEON (1P1) [2005-2013]
[2005-2013]
1P0837402E |
5
-
125602
£ 63.85
Shipping and VAT
are
included
in the price.
3 to 5 working days
9
10
11
12
13
30kg+
Read more about
CO₂
savings